It was revealed yesterday Shakira is facing a new tax battle With the Spanish authorities, The singer has decided to break her silence with the help of a group of lawyers who have been advising her for years.

According to a statement released by his lawyers, the Colombian learned of this backlash against him thanks to the publication in various media, but not through an official document.

“Once again, as has been the case all these years, the singer found out about the filing of this lawsuit through the media, which demonstrates the pressure she has been subjected to in terms of media and reputation. As officially notified to the Spanish Treasury, “Shakira has been living in Miami for a few months, so she must be personally notified of her new address as established by law,” the letter reads.

Likewise, Shakira’s legal representatives have given assurances pending a response from the authorities concernedHe will continue to focus on his new career in Miami and his successes at the professional level.

Shakira’s success at Premios Juventud has faded

Shakira won the Premios Juventud with eight awards, followed by Carol G and Featherweight, according to EFE’s official reports on the total number of awards.

Colombian singer Shakira emerged as the first winner of the twentieth edition of the awards presented in Puerto Rico on Thursday. “This island that I worship and meet all of you, thank you very much,” declared the performer in a red dress and heels in front of a packed Coliseo de Puerto Rico in San Juan.

Shakira also sent a message thanking all of her followers, insisting they were her “very lucky”.

During this Univision Network event’s gala, Shakira won awards for Best Pop/Urban Song (“Shakira: BZRP Music Sessions #53”), Artist Premios Juventud Femenina, Best Song for My Ex (“TQG”), Girl Power (“TQG”), Best Urban Track (“TQGopical Mix, Community DQGopl”), Best Urban Track (“TQG, DQG.
